At Copper, we value your trust and are committed to protecting your privacy. We understand that there might be times when you wish to delete your account, and we want to ensure that the process is straightforward and transparent. Here's what you need to know about deleting your Copper account:
If you wish to delete your account, please be aware that we have specific procedures in place to maintain the integrity of our system and comply with legal requirements.
To delete your Copper account, please contact our customer support team through the in-app chatbot by entering “delete account” and follow prompts to Customer Service. This is the most secure way to contact us, as you are already securely logged in to your account.
We will guide you through the process.

Waiting Period: To prevent misuse of the platform, we've implemented a 30-day waiting period for deleting Earn profiler information. This period allows us to ensure that account deletions are genuine.
Tax Obligations: If you earn more than $600 in a year through Copper, we're required to issue a W-9 form to meet IRS requirements. Consequently, your personal information, such as name, email, and the amount earned, will be retained for tax purposes. This data will be securely stored and used only if necessary, for instance, if you restart an account within the same tax year.

General Data Retention Policy
In line with our commitment to your privacy and legal compliance, we retain personal data only as long as necessary to provide our services, fulfill transactions, comply with legal obligations, resolve disputes, and enforce our agreements. The retention periods vary based on several factors, including the type of service provided, user consent, data sensitivity, and our legal or contractual obligations.
